PBA suspends 3x3 matches, Game 6 in danger after Big Dome fire

A fire broke out at the Smart Araneta Coliseum on Wednesday, April 20, forcing the suspension of the PBA 3x3 Grand Finals and possibly Game 6 of the PBA Governors’ Cup Finals.

The incident occurred before noon, forcing PBA 3x3 teams and officials to evacuate after smoke coming from the Red Gate was seen during the pool play match between Purefoods and Pioneer.

At least six fire trucks entered the Big Dome premises while about two or three more were waiting outside before fire was declared out. No one was hurt but the league declared that the Grand Finals will be rescheduled on a later date. Fire was declared out shortly after 1 p.m.

The PBA is also waiting for words from fire officials and Araneta if Game 6 between Barangay Ginebra San Miguel and Meralco will proceed as scheduled.

Ginebra is looking to secure the crown in the game slated for a 6 p.m. tipoff.
